Quick Cinnamon Rolls
Take a tube of crescent rolls (or regular dinner rolls) open, flatten each roll a little, and spread generously with Heloise's cinnamon butter. Roll up and bake according to the directions on the tube (if using glass baking dish lower temp 25 degrees)
You can add nuts & raisins if you like.
Cinnamon butter
1/2 pound butter
3 tablespoons cinnamon
1/2 pound powdered sugar
Combine ingredients and mix well using an electric mixer. Store in an airtight container in the fridge.

I do the block of cream cheese with Jalapeno Jelly over it to serve with crackers (We like wheat thins). You can also put any gourmet jelly over it, we like ones with habanero peppers or horseradish in them.
Or tiny shrimp over the cream cheese then cocktail sauce.

I do it in a glass 9x13 baking dish. I also spray in a little pam then wipe it out with a paper towel.
Spread a 20 oz. can of crushed pineapple on the bottom of the pan. Add 1 teaspoon vanilla. Then sprinkle a Betty Crocker angel food cake mix over that ( it must be one step kind)
Mix all together well, it will start to foam. Let set 20 minutes to rise. Bake in a preheated oven 20 to 25 minutes. Place on a wire rack to cool. When cool frost with a container of cool whip. (we like low fat ) Cover tightly and refrigerate until ready to serve.
